Item 4.01. Changes in Registrant’s Independent Registered Public Accounting Firm.

On September 7, 2004, Interphase Corporation (“Registrant”) dismissed P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P as its independent registered public accounting firm. The Registrant’s Audit Committee of the Board of Directors participated in and approved the decision to change the Registrant’s independent registered public accounting firm.

The reports of P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P on the financial statements for the past two fiscal years contained no adverse opinion or disclaimer of opinion and were not qualified or modified as to uncertainty, audit scope or accounting principle.

In connection with its audits for the two most recent fiscal years and through September 7, 2004, there have been no disagreements with P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P on any matter of accounting principles or practices, financial statement disclosure, or auditing scope or procedure, which disagreements if not resolved to the satisfaction of P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P would have caused them to make reference thereto in their reports on the financial statements for such years.

During the two most recent fiscal years and through September 7, 2004, there have been no reportable events (as defined in Regulation S-K Item 304(a)(1)(v)).

The Registrant has requested that P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P furnish it with a letter addressed to the Securities and Exchange Commission stating whether or not it agrees with the above statements. A copy of such letter, dated September 13, 2004, is filed as Exhibit 16.1 to this Current Report on Form 8-K.

The Registrant engaged Grant Thornton LLP as its new independent registered public accounting firm effective September 9, 2004. During the two most recent fiscal years and through September 9, 2004, the Registrant did not consult with Grant Thornton LLP regarding (i) the application of accounting principles to a specified transaction, either completed or proposed; or the type of audit opinion that might be rendered on the Registrant’s financial statements, and neither a written report or oral advice was provided to the Registrant that the Registrant concluded was an important factor considered by the Registrant in reaching a decision as to an accounting, auditing or financial reporting issue; or (ii) any matter that was either the subject of a disagreement, as that term is defined in Item 304(a)(1)(iv) of Regulation S-K and the related instructions to Item 304 of Regulation S-K, or a reportable event.

The Registrant has requested that Grant Thornton LLP review the disclosure in this Current Report on Form 8-K and provided Grant Thornton LLP the opportunity to furnish the Registrant with a letter addressed to the Commission containing any new information, clarification of the Registrant’s expression of its views, or the respects in which Grant Thornton does not agree with the statements made by the Registrant in this Current Report. Grant Thornton LLP has advised the Registrant that no such letter will be issued.
